BWW Review: Justin Vivian Bond Is 'Golden' in Anniversary Show at Joe's Pub
by Troy Frisby - Sep 23, 2016

If this is what the end of the GOLDEN AGE OF JUSTIN VIVIAN BOND looks like, here's hoping for an extension. Before capping off a yearlong celebration of Bond's 25th anniversary of being a performer with a VIVification benefit, v's---Bond's preferred pronoun---GOLDEN AGE was a fever dream, full of charming anecdotes about shared psychoanalysts, spirit guides and Blythe Danner. On the second evening of the show's four-night run earlier this month, Bond's control over the melodic rasp of v's voice was impeccable. More importantly, v displayed an unmatched talent for controlling the space v's in, owning the entire stage with little more than a gentle sway and the tap of a heel, making Bond's all-out performance look effortless.

Bebe Neuwirth, James Monroe Iglehart & More Set for 2016 24 Hour Musicals
by Tyler Peterson - Apr 22, 2016

On May 2nd, The 24 Hour Company® is teaming with The Exchange, an off-Broadway theater company, to create the eighth annual The 24 Hour Musicals to be held at the Highline Ballroom. A team of more than 100 - including stars from Broadway, film, television, and music - will cast, write, compose, direct, rehearse, tech, and perform four original musicals - all in the obscenely short time between an evening meet-and-greet on Sunday, May 1st and show time on Monday, May 2 at 8pm. The event benefits the Exchange's summer program, The Orchard Project, which incubates and accelerates innovative new theatrical work from around the world.
